Will Mark Sanchez Be The Next Big Thing?

With the football season being so young only three weeks in, it is hard to really gauge where the young players are. This season, however, we are fortunate to have two NFL draft pick rookies starting for NFL football teams right from the first gun of the season. Three games in, and both Mark Sanchez and Matthew Stafford have seen some success. Who has been the most impressive so far?

On the surface it would appear that Sanchez has been the best in a landslide, but much of that has to do with the players around him. Sanchez is 3-0 as a in his brief NFL career, but his defense has as much to do with that as anything that he has done. Do not get me wrong – Sanchez has looked fantastic so far. The thing about Sanchez that is shocking to me is how poised he has been. The guy never looks rattled, and that is a sign of a future NFL superstar at such a young age. He has a quarterback rating of just below 90 which is great and has only thrown 2 picks against 4 Touchdowns. Again, that is impressive.

Stafford has had his moments as well. The problem that Stafford faces is that he plays for the Lions. This guy is already being thrown into situations that create character or destroys young quarterbacks. Thus far, he has stood up quite well though the stats do not seem like it. He is 1-2 with a quarterback rating of 57.0. He has also thrown two touchdowns and 5 picks. This is partly because they have played from behind all season with the exception of that lone win against the Redskins.

All in all, the competition is pretty darn close. I do give the nod to Sanchez for one reason. He has shown an ability to throw the deep ball as he has three passes over 40 yds so far. While not mind boggling, this is certainly respectable for an NFL that is only now getting their feet wet.

Who will be the better quarterback in the end is anybody’s guess, but I have a feeling they will both be around for a very long time. These are two great young talents. Hopefully they are not snake bitten by their respective teams. They are for real.

pddolphincheer 243x300 AFC East NFL Picks and Predictions For 2009The AFC East in recent years has been pretty much all about the Patriots for the last several seasons with the lone exception of last year.  In a very odd 2008 season, the mighty Patriots lost quarterback Tom Brady and dropped to second place behind Miami via a tie breaker.  This season, Brady is back but does that mean that the AFC East is a gimme once again?  Let’s look into the crystal ball for 2009, and see what stares back at us.

New England Patriots

While the Patriots are not the powerhouse they have been in previous seasons, they are still awfully good.  This version of the Patriots has just as strong of a chance in winning the division as any, and I expect that Brady will return to form quickly and decidedly.  Randy Moss, Brady, newcomer Fred Taylor, and many others will keep the Patriots near the top of the standings all season long.  I expect them to reclaim the AFC East crown.

Miami Dolphins

The Dolphins sprung from nowhere to take the playoff spot in the AFC East last season and they will not sneak up on anyone this year.  The Dolphins are a solid football team but they do have some question marks.  Will Ronnie Brown be able to hold up this season?  Will the wildcat be effective again?  Can the Tuna work some more magic?  I see second place in this talented division.

pdpatriots 300x214 AFC East NFL Picks and Predictions For 2009

The Bills are one of those teams that is really hard to figure out.  They have some serious talent and that new guy…. Terrell Owens.  They have a quarterback that might just explode now that the Bills have more than just Lee Evans to throw to.  It should be fun to watch.  The Bills will come in a strong third, and would not surprise me at all to go higher.

New York Jets

The Jets will struggle this season because they seem committed to rookie quarterback Mark Sanchez.  He is a fantastic talent and I do see him succeeding in his rookie year, but there will be growing pains for sure.  Expect that Sanchez will play alot, and the Jets will win a little.  This will be a good thing in the long run for the Jets.
